TLC LAUNCHES MULTIPLATFORM TLCme VIDEO HUB FEATURING DIGITAL SERIES WITH INFLUENCERS IN STYLE, HOME, BEAUTY AND PARENTING

- Four Lifestyle Vloggers and Influencers Share Tips and Tricks With The TLC Audience -

(Silver Spring, MD) - One year after launching TLC's multi-platform brand extension, TLCme.com, TLC is officially in the business of creating original video content for its digital and linear platforms. The TLCme.com video hub provides the latest stories on style, beauty, weddings, family, home and more. Led by a slate of lifestyle experts and influencers, TLCme's new original video offerings include:

· Estee on TLCme: Building off of her successful 1.1M-subscribed YouTube vlogs, Estee Lalonde brings her no-nonsense beauty, style and DIY secrets to the TLC audience.

· Erica In The House: Hosted by the DIY guru behind P.S. - I Made This, Erica Domesek takes viewers on her journey of making her house a home. Domesek provides tips, tricks and solutions to throwing the perfect dinner party, whipping up festive treats and how to decorate your home with dollar-store finds.

· #NewMomDiaries: Jess Zaino is an on-air personality, celebrity stylist and Emmy-nominated style producer turned working mom juggling it all. Zaino shares her tips and tricks for surviving life with a new human clinging to you.

· TLCme Now: The radio host and nationally syndicated star, Danni Starr, hosts a weekly primetime, on-air roundup where she shares top stories and tips of the week, including simple ways to clean your house in five minutes, holiday hosting tips and more.

"We are so excited to be partnering with these tastemakers and influencers in the digital and social space," said Scott Lewers, SVP of Programming and Multiplatform Strategy for TLC. "We are making great forays into original video content on the topics that are ever-important to our key millennial audience."

Since its launch, TLCme.com has seen up to 2.2 monthly unique visitors largely driven from the mobile platform and nearly half of which are W18-34. Whether these tastemakers are catching you up on buzz-worthy stories, sharing #momhacks, designing eye-popping bookshelves, or demonstrating easy makeup tips, Erica, Jess, Estee and Danni have something for everyone, when and how they want to consume it.

About TLC

Offering remarkably relatable real-life stories without judgment, TLC shares everyday heart, humor, hope, and human connection with programming genres that include fascinating families, heartwarming transformations, and life's milestone moments. In 2015, TLC was a top 10 cable network with women and had 26 series averaging 1 million P2+ viewers or more.

TLC is a global brand available in more than 93 million homes in the US and 332 million households in 189 markets internationally. A destination online, TLC.com offers in-depth fan sites and exclusive original video content. Fans can also interact with TLC through social media on Facebook, Instagram, Pinterest and @TLC on Twitter as well as On Demand services, YouTube and mobile platforms. TLC is part of Discovery Communications (NASDAQ: DISCA, DISCB, DISCK), the world's #1 pay-TV programmer reaching 3 billion cumulative subscribers in 220 countries and territories.
